Our Scripture reading today is Nehemiah 2:17-18.
Verse 18, "Then I told them of the hand of my God which was good upon me; as also the king's words that he had spoken unto me. And they said, Let us rise up and build. So they strengthened their hands for this good work."
Nehemiah was on a mission to rebuild the walls of Jerusalem.  This mission began when he heard about the condition of the city in chapter 1.  The need was fully known to Nehemiah after he saw with his own eyes the devastation.  (Chapter 2:11-15)  Wall re-building would require many labourers and much materials.  Nehemiah makes it clear that not only had the king given them his blessing but the hand of almighty God was on them as well.  This brought greater security than anything else.
